What's the Climate Like?
Monthly averages — select a city to compare.
Avg. annual high / low
Avg. annual high / low
| Months | Port Vila | Kuwait City |
|---|---|---|
| Jan–Mar | 86°/74°F (30°/23°C) | 73°/51°F (23°/11°C) |
| Apr–Jun | 82°/70°F (28°/21°C) | 104°/76°F (40°/25°C) |
| Jul–Sep | 79°/67°F (26°/19°C) | 114°/84°F (46°/29°C) |
| Oct–Dec | 84°/71°F (29°/22°C) | 84°/60°F (29°/15°C) |

Is Kuwait safe for expats?
Kuwait performs significantly better than Vanuatu across all safety metrics. The homicide rate in Kuwait is 0.2 per 100,000 people, compared to 0.3 in Vanuatu.
How is healthcare in Kuwait compared to Vanuatu?
Kuwait generally does better on health & wellbeing, though Vanuatu leads in healthcare spending per person. There are 22.9 doctors per 10,000 people in Kuwait, compared to 1.6 in Vanuatu. Kuwait scores 78 on the WHO universal health coverage index (Vanuatu: 47).
What's the weather like in Kuwait compared to Vanuatu?
The average high temperature in Kuwait City is 94°F, compared to 83°F in Port Vila. Kuwait City receives around 4.6 in of rainfall per year, while Port Vila gets 87.5 in.
What language do they speak in Kuwait?
The official language in Kuwait is Arabic. In Vanuatu, the official languages are Bislama, English and French.
